Transaction 6899593a296f256956518ab0e790c2acae3b36b5227d9a71198fd3f6ddb8653a
1 Input
1 Output
-
6899593a296f256956518ab0e790c2acae3b36b5227d9a71198fd3f6ddb8653a:0
- value
- 312722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a69f7baa1f64cf0892f088c7bab80d1012a4912 OP_EQUAL
- address
- 39w5gaB5SUzwrtwiRUgXjDyJ9hcZEC2eYh